From 2797a10fcb78d23077127c41e5c348b7c32f0bfc Mon Sep 17 00:00:00 2001 From: kjubybot Date: Tue, 17 May 2022 15:00:51 +0300 Subject: [PATCH] fixed pipeline --- Jenkinsfile-sast | 20 +++++++++++--------- 1 file changed, 11 insertions(+), 9 deletions(-) diff --git a/Jenkinsfile-sast b/Jenkinsfile-sast index b71393a..8e6ae2a 100644 --- a/Jenkinsfile-sast +++ b/Jenkinsfile-sast @@ -20,15 +20,17 @@ spec: DEPCHECKDB = credentials('depcheck-postgres') } steps { - sh 'apk update && apk add openjdk11 java-postgresql-jdbc go' - dependencyCheck additionalArguments: '-f JSON -f HTML -n --enableExperimental \ - -l deplog \ - --dbDriverName org.postgresql.Driver \ - --dbDriverPath /usr/share/java/postgresql-jdbc.jar \ - --dbUser $DEPCHECKDB_USR \ - --dbPassword $DEPCHECKDB_PSW \ - --connectionString jdbc:postgresql://postgres-postgresql.postgres/depcheck', odcInstallation: 'depcheck' - sh 'cat deplog' + container('alpine') { + sh 'apk update && apk add openjdk11 java-postgresql-jdbc go' + dependencyCheck additionalArguments: '-f JSON -f HTML -n --enableExperimental \ + -l deplog \ + --dbDriverName org.postgresql.Driver \ + --dbDriverPath /usr/share/java/postgresql-jdbc.jar \ + --dbUser $DEPCHECKDB_USR \ + --dbPassword $DEPCHECKDB_PSW \ + --connectionString jdbc:postgresql://postgres-postgresql.postgres/depcheck', odcInstallation: 'depcheck' + sh 'cat deplog' + } } } stage('SonarQube analysis') {